Responsibilities

  • Prepare, review, and organize land use and zoning board applications.
  • Coordinate filing of applications with municipal planning and zoning boards.
  • Prepare notices, affidavits of publication, service lists, and related application documents.
  • Obtain certified property owner (200-foot) lists and coordinate service of notices.
  • Communicate with municipal officials, engineers, architects, planners, surveyors, and clients regarding application requirements.
  • Schedule hearings, meetings, inspections, and client appointments.
  • Maintain calendars for application deadlines, hearing dates, and post-approval compliance.
  • Draft routine correspondence, legal documents, transmittal letters, and forms.
  • Assemble hearing packets and exhibits.
  • Order title searches, tax certifications, and other due diligence documents as needed.
  • Manage electronic and physical client files.
  • Assist attorney with preparation for Planning Board and Zoning Board hearings.
  • Track municipal approvals, resolutions, recording requirements, and conditions of approval.
